How do u win fantasy football?

You get points for the yards, touchdowns, field goals, and other stats your players produce in real life, and so does your opponent. At the end of the week's games, whoever has more points gets a win. This goes on for the whole season, eventually leading to a champion.

Who invented fantasy football?

Fantasy gridiron football emerged in 1962 when Bill Winkenbach, then part owner of the Oakland Raiders football team, gathered with some friends in a New York City hotel, and together they created the first fantasy football league, which was dubbed the GOPPPL (Greater Oakland Professional Pigskin Prognosticators League ...

Do your bench players get points in fantasy football?

Players on the bench, known as 'bench players,' will also earn fantasy points for their performance in games but those points will not be added to your team total for head to head matchups. In some leagues, bench points are used as a tie-breaker should the two teams score the same amount of points.

How did fantasy sports become legal?

The DFS industry gained traction in 2006 upon the signing of the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act (UIGEA). UIEGA essentially ended the online poker industry but provided an exemption for fantasy sports. A year after UIGEA's enactment, Fantasy Sports Live was launched, becoming the first major DFS gaming site.
